BeamOn HP High Power Beam Analysis
Description
Duma's High Power Laser Measuring Device is a robust all-in-one instrument with built-in state-of-the-art air-cooled beam dump, operating from 350 - 1600 nm lasers. It will measure M², BPP (Beam Propagation Parameters), Beam size at its focal position down to less than 100 microns. A unique feature allows measurement of power variation at a rate of 5 times per second. A special user-friendly software will display results on an industrial computer or using a USB interface for customer's computer.

Specifications |
|
---|---|
Sensor Type: | CCD |
Measurable Sources: | CW, Pulsed |
Wavelength Range: | 350-1310nm |
# Pixels (Width): | 1040 |
# Pixels (Height): | 1392 |
Pixel Size (Width): | 8.6 um |
Pixel Size (Height): | 8.3 um |
Max Full Frame Rate: | 25 Hz |
ADC: | 12-bit |
